Output 93fa24df085de10c3a449445334fba42b1c38f8e3d7bac426242d654786981d8:0

value
6875423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f9e64bc834e76b33cded3b9ec1909bef0a4d9a OP_EQUAL
address
36tH8cbDhkkrUqpWCf7oeK5vcvC7HQx7v1
transaction
93fa24df085de10c3a449445334fba42b1c38f8e3d7bac426242d654786981d8
spent
true